Grasping Commerce Entity Types
When launching a company, one of the first decisions entrepreneurs confront is selecting the appropriate company entity type. The selection of entity impacts all aspects from taxes and liability to financing and business operations. The widely recognized forms of company types include sole proprietorships, partnerships, LLCs, and corporations. Every entity form has its benefits and disadvantages, which can considerably influence how a venture is run and taxed.
A sole proprietorship is the most straightforward type, allowing individuals to operate their business without formal incorporation. Although it gives ease of setup and full control to the proprietor, the drawback is that personal assets can be at risk in the case of business debts or judicial issues. Collaborations, on the other hand, permit two or more individuals to distribute the risks and rewards of the venture. This structure necessitates clear agreements to define each participant's role and distribution arrangement, but it can be complicated if conflicts occur.
Limited liability companies and incorporations offer a higher level of safeguarding for personal assets. An LLC combines the adaptability of a collaboration with the liability protection of a corporation. Corporations, while more complex to form and sustain, offer the benefit of limited liability and simpler entry to capital through stock offerings. Comprehending these business types is essential for entrepreneurs as they traverse the beginning stages of establishing their company and ensuring legal adherence.

How to Perform a Business Name Inquiry
Performing a company title search is important for business owners who want to confirm their selected title is one-of-a-kind and not already in use. Begin by navigating to the California Secretary of State's website, in which you can utilize their inquiry features. Entering your preferred name into the search bar will yield findings related to any currently registered businesses with that title. This is the initial step in ensuring availability, which can aid prevent potential conflicts in the future.
Once you have made use of the California SoS business search tool, examine the search results carefully. Look for related names and differences since even slight changes can influence your brand visibility. Record any active entities that may lead to misunderstanding or potential trademark conflicts. Comprehending these nuances is important for establishing a singular identity in the commercial space.
If your inquiry shows that your desired name is open, consider a few further checks. Check the State of California Doing Business As inquiry for any fictitious business name registrations that could impact your selection. Also, it's recommended to check social media platforms and domain name availability to confirm a unified online footprint. This comprehensive approach will strengthen your business identity and support your brand's growth.
Ensuring Positive Status for Your Company
Maintaining good standing for your business is crucial for sustained activities and growth. When your business is in positive status, it indicates to partners, funders, and consumers that your company is in adherence with legal obligations. One important action in this journey is to consistently check your company status through platforms like the California's Secretary of State's entity search. This tool provides you to quickly access information on your business's status, making sure that you are aware of any requirements or filings needed to keep your business in good standing.
In CA, a business that falls out of positive status may face serious repercussions, such as monetary penalties or the inability to conduct business lawfully. To prevent these challenges, company leaders should take advantage of the California's Secretary of State's various search features. The business entity search allows you to verify if your company is in compliance or if there are outstanding issues that need to be managed. Consistent reviews of your company status can shield you from upcoming legal issues and guarantee that your activities run efficiently.
Moreover, being in good standing is important if you hope to seek financing, secure agreements, or grow your business. Banks and partners often demand proof of compliance as part of their due diligence protocol. Using the features available on the Secretary of State's website, such as the business lookup and name availability checks, can enhance your trustworthiness and help sustain your business's image. By proactively managing your company's status, you can prioritize growth while guaranteeing compliance with legal requirements.
